How the Games Mirror the Casino’s False Promises
Slot mechanics are a perfect metaphor for the whole “top 20” circus. Starburst darts across the reels with lightning‑quick wins, giving you the illusion of momentum, only to vanish before you can bank a decent profit. Gonzo’s Quest, on the other hand, digs deep with high volatility, delivering a few massive payouts that feel like a mirage in a desert.
And the rest? There’s a whole slew of titles that promise big wins but are engineered to keep you betting indefinitely – the same way the “top 20” list keeps you scrolling for the next shiny promotion.
What Really Determines a Worthy Casino?
First, the licensing. A UKGC licence is a baseline, not a badge of honour. Second, the banking options – you’ll find more than a dozen e‑wallets, but every extra method adds another layer of verification that can drain your patience.
And then there’s the customer support. A live chat that disappears after five minutes is about as useful as a slot that never hits a bonus round. If you ever manage to get through, you’ll hear the same scripted apology about “technical issues” while your withdrawal stalls.
